## Regional Sales Review — Q2 (Managers Only)

Quick rundown for the board before Thursday. The Ashvale region carried us again — up 14% on the Pinefold product line, mostly thanks to Dara Holloway's team landing two mid-market accounts. Corlin region slipped 6%; churn there traces back to the botched onboarding push in spring, now fixed. Thornby is flat but pipeline looks healthier than it has in a year. We're reallocating two reps from Corlin to Ashvale for Q3. The confidential part of the regional plan is summarized below.

board note of kafog-bajep: Briathek Partners is in early talks to buy Aldaelek Group for about $47.1 million. The Ulaath launch date is September 4, and nothing goes to the press before then.

/*
 * Heads up: this client wires the old Gradlepond build into
 * our new hermetic setup under Boxkiln. Everything now runs
 * in sealed sandboxes — no network, no ambient toolchains —
 * so all deps get fetched up front through the Boxkiln proxy.
 * If the release build stalls at "resolving external inputs,"
 * it's almost always the proxy auth, not the graph. The proxy
 * authenticates against our internal artifact service, and
 * the key it expects is right below.
 */

API key for fahip-kahip: zpat23_XiJGUHz5xfaAtaIqUkus0rh

- [ ] Step 7: Archive cold storage buckets (Glacierline tier). Confirm both ceremony witnesses are present, verify bucket manifests match the Oxbow ledger, then seal the archive key shares. Plugin authors may observe but not handle shares. Once sealed, the archive index itself is encrypted and can only be reopened with the passphrase below.

vault phrase of badup-hahig = tamael-aldael-kelmir-istael-fenok-istwyn-tamius-jorath-oliion

// Static-analysis baseline for the Quillstone repo.
// The baseline file (lint-baseline.json) freezes all pre-existing
// findings so CI only fails on NEW issues. Do not hand-edit it.
// Regenerate only after a deliberate cleanup sprint, and note the
// diff in the weekly eng sync. Baseline drift over 50 entries
// triggers an automatic ticket against the owning squad.
// Uploads to the Marrowbird analysis service go through this
// client, which authenticates using the key on the next line.

service key, bawip-kawip: zpat4_kOcB